This document clarifies who may consent to treatment, reduces delays in urgent care, and documents consent in writing for clinical and administrative records. It helps providers rely on documented authorization while protecting patient autonomy and minimizing disputes about decision authority.
Common users include parents, guardians, adult children, caregivers, and institutional staff arranging temporary care for a patient.
Full legal name, date of birth, and identifying information so clinicians can match records and verify the subject of the authorization.
Name and contact details of the person empowered to consent, plus relationship to the patient and any identification requirements.
Specify permitted treatments (medical, surgical, mental health), whether consent for medication, immunizations, or hospital admission is included.
Exact start and end dates or event-based termination (for example, 'until return on MM/DD/YYYY' or 'until revoked in writing').
Any explicit exclusions such as refusal of blood transfusion, elective surgery, or long-term care decisions.
Signature of the authorizing party, printed name, and date; include witness or notary block if required by state or facility.
